#4c9897 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c9897 is composed of 29.8% red, 59.6%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.7%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 179.2 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 44.7%. #4c9897 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00312f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#4c9897

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040808 is the darkest color, while #fafd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c9897

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7575 is the less saturated color, while #06dedb is the most saturated one.
